Transaction f8f376961ddc116dae87032e289824439fc20f9ac971b3a99083d5497ad7139d
1 Input
2 Outputs
- f8f376961ddc116dae87032e289824439fc20f9ac971b3a99083d5497ad7139d:0
- f8f376961ddc116dae87032e289824439fc20f9ac971b3a99083d5497ad7139d:1
value 27451373
address 16r7ctKCKzuRUH7MG7pFpYN1USoNrKRE95
value 3386903
address 1Fwq9SFHbyn73eEvfrCKVFm6x5JMgTce59